Describe the main features of the policy/measure:
The status of the artist is a key area for the further development of the cultural and creative sector and is a direct response to the crisis. It also represents one of the Council's six key priorities under the Working
Plan for Culture 2019-2022 (i.e. an ecosystem supporting artists and workers of the cultural
and creative industries and European content). As such, the status of the artist contributes to the
European pillar of social rights and in line with the Sustainable Development Goals
of the UN (SDG 8 and SDG 10). Last but not least, it should be noted that the cultural and creative sector is an essential
sector for youth and women's employment.
